Abstract

An approach for predistorting signals to be transmitted via a multicarrier satellite transponder to account for inter-symbol interference. Multiple source signals are received. A transmit filter model is applied to each source signal to generate a respective filtered signal. Each filtered signal is translated to a carrier frequency, and the translated signals are summed to generate a composite signal. A common non-linearity model is applied to the composite signal to generate a model transmit signal. The transmit signal is translated to generate a receive signal estimate for each of the filtered signals. A receive filter model is applied to each receive estimate to generate a filtered estimate. Each filtered estimate is subtracted from the respective source signal to generate an error sequence. A fraction of the error sequence is added to the respective source signal to generate a predistorted signal for transmission via a multicarrier satellite transponder.

Claims (10)

1 . A method comprising:

receiving a plurality of source signals;

applying a transmit filter model to each of the source signals to generate a respective filtered signal for each source signal;

translating each of the filtered signals to a respective carrier frequency;

summing the translated signals to generate a composite signal;

applying a common non-linearity model to the composite signal to generate a model transmit signal;

translating the transmit signal to generate a receive signal estimate of each of the filtered signals;

applying a receive filter model to each of the receive signal estimates to generate a filtered receive signal estimate;

subtracting each filtered receive signal estimate from the respective source signal to generate an error sequence for the respective filtered receive signal estimate; and

adding a fraction of the error sequence for each filtered receive signal estimate to the respective source signal to generate a respective predistorted signal for transmission via a multicarrier satellite transponder.
